Package-level declarations
Types
Link copied to clipboard
data class EnvironmentLoggingConfiguration(val dagProcessingLogs: EnvironmentModuleLoggingConfiguration? = null, val schedulerLogs: EnvironmentModuleLoggingConfiguration? = null, val taskLogs: EnvironmentModuleLoggingConfiguration? = null, val webserverLogs: EnvironmentModuleLoggingConfiguration? = null, val workerLogs: EnvironmentModuleLoggingConfiguration? = null)
Logging configuration for the environment.
Link copied to clipboard
data class EnvironmentModuleLoggingConfiguration(val cloudWatchLogGroupArn: String? = null, val enabled: Boolean? = null, val logLevel: EnvironmentLoggingLevel? = null)
Logging configuration for a specific airflow component.
Link copied to clipboard
data class EnvironmentNetworkConfiguration(val securityGroupIds: List<String>? = null, val subnetIds: List<String>? = null)
Configures the network resources of the environment.
Link copied to clipboard
data class GetEnvironmentResult(val airflowConfigurationOptions: Any? = null, val airflowVersion: String? = null, val arn: String? = null, val celeryExecutorQueue: String? = null, val dagS3Path: String? = null, val databaseVpcEndpointService: String? = null, val environmentClass: String? = null, val executionRoleArn: String? = null, val loggingConfiguration: EnvironmentLoggingConfiguration? = null, val maxWebservers: Int? = null, val maxWorkers: Int? = null, val minWebservers: Int? = null, val minWorkers: Int? = null, val networkConfiguration: EnvironmentNetworkConfiguration? = null, val pluginsS3ObjectVersion: String? = null, val pluginsS3Path: String? = null, val requirementsS3ObjectVersion: String? = null, val requirementsS3Path: String? = null, val schedulers: Int? = null, val sourceBucketArn: String? = null, val startupScriptS3ObjectVersion: String? = null, val startupScriptS3Path: String? = null, val tags: Any? = null, val webserverAccessMode: EnvironmentWebserverAccessMode? = null, val webserverUrl: String? = null, val webserverVpcEndpointService: String? = null, val weeklyMaintenanceWindowStart: String? = null)